Myrtle Beach – The 2025 CNB Kickoff Classic is set to take place on Friday, August 15, 2025, at Doug Shaw Memorial Stadium, marking the event’s 35th anniversary. The kickoff is scheduled for 6 p.m. and will feature local high school football teams engaged in a series of scrimmages, showcasing the talent of young athletes in the region.

The annual classic has a rich history, previously held at Brooks Stadium at Coastal Carolina University. This year, however, the event is relocating due to turf renovations at the university’s facility. The change in venue is expected to enhance the experience for both players and attendees.

The lineup for this year’s kickoff includes several exciting matchups:
– Game 1: St. James vs. Green Sea Floyds
– Game 2: Waccamaw vs. Conway
– Game 3: North Myrtle Beach vs. Myrtle Beach
– Game 4: Socastee vs. Aynor
– Game 5: Carolina Forest vs. Loris

This event not only serves as a showcase for local talent but also reinforces community support for high school sports. All proceeds from ticket sales will be evenly distributed among the participating schools, promoting financial support for their athletic programs. Tickets are anticipated to go on sale two weeks before the event and will be available both online and at local Conway National Bank branches.

The CNB Kickoff Classic is often considered the unofficial start to the football season in Horry and Georgetown Counties. The event has evolved into a beloved tradition, fostering community engagement and anticipation for the upcoming season.
